Abstract

A silicon-carbon composite material includes a matrix core, a silicon-carbon composite shell formed by uniformly dispersing nano silicon particles in conductive carbon, and a coating layer. The nano silicon particles are formed by high-temperature pyrolysis of a silicon source, and the conductive carbon is formed by high-temperature pyrolysis of an organic carbon source. The coating layer is a carbon coating layer including at least one layer, and the thickness of its single layer is 0.2-3 μm. A silicon-carbon composite material precursor is formed by simultaneous vapor deposition and is then subjected to carbon coating to form the pitaya-like silicon-carbon composite material which has advantages of high first-cycle efficiency, low expansion and long cycle. The grain growth of the silicon material is slowed down during the heat treatment process, the pulverization of the material is effectively avoided, and the cycle performance, conductivity and rate performance of the material are enhanced.
